The image, taken from behind a set of black metal window bars featuring circular and floral motifs, depicts a scene in Khan Yunis, Palestinian Territory, under a partly cloudy sky. In the immediate foreground, a concrete window sill is visible, upon which a small, light-colored wooden object rests. Beyond the bars, the scene opens to a large, unpaved, sandy or dusty area. This area is uneven and scattered with debris. A substantial pile of concrete and structural rubble, indicative of a demolished building, occupies the left-center midground. Adjacent to this rubble pile on the left, a light-colored tent and a blue tarp are visible. Several individuals are present in the sandy area. One person, dressed in a light-colored top and dark trousers, walks alone in the central-left portion, casting a distinct shadow. Further to the right, a group of approximately three to four individuals in dark clothing are gathered or seated on the ground amidst debris. Closer to the foreground and slightly right, another two to three individuals, also in dark attire, are standing. In the background, multiple multi-story buildings line the horizon. These structures exhibit extensive damage, including blown-out windows, shattered glass, visible interior spaces through gaping holes in the walls, and facades pitted with impact marks. A prominent building in the center background features an arched decorative element and communication towers/antennas on its roof. To its right, another building shows severe structural damage and also has communication equipment on its rooftop. The overall environment suggests significant urban destruction.
